Could a Tiger 2 tank beat an Abrams? (2024)

So right off the bat, the Tiger II's 88mm cannon would not be able to penetrate the Abram's armor. The Abrams cannon would easily destroy Tigers from ranges that the Tigers couldn't dream of.

Can a T-72 destroy an Abrams?

During the first Gulf War three kinetic energy piercing rounds from a T-72 hit the M1A1 armor but unable to fully penetrate but the external damage was enough to send the Abrams to get repaired. Six other M1A1s were allegedly hit by 125 mm tank fire, but the impacts were largely ineffectual.

What could destroy a tiger tank?

The M3 90 mm cannon used as a towed anti-aircraft and anti-tank gun, and later mounted in the M36 tank destroyer and finally the late-war M26 Pershing, could penetrate the Tiger's front plate at a range of 1,000 m using standard ammunition, and from beyond 2,000 m when using HVAP.

Has an Abrams ever been destroyed by another tank?

Of the nine Abrams tanks destroyed, seven were destroyed by friendly fire and two intentionally destroyed to prevent capture by the Iraqi Army. No M1s were lost to enemy tank fire. Some others took minor combat damage, with little effect on their operational readiness.

What was the Tiger tank weakness?

Its main weakness was its Maybach engine which was underpowered when compared to the size of the vehicle. The Tigers wide tracks and Torsion bar suspension, however, provided for good cross country performance, but the overlapping wheel design proved a heavy maintenance overhead.

Is it true that fifty t 34s lost a battle against one Tiger I tank?

On July 8th, 1943, a Tiger tank commanded by Franz Staudegger took on fifty attacking T-34 tanks as the only armored vehicle on its side (though it did have infantry support), destroying twenty-seven enemy tanks and forcing the remainder to break off their attack and fall back.
